FRENCH ORDER
An order, in French, for a copy of “The Press Games Review” taxed the linguistic abilities of “The Press” commercial staff yesterday, but it was eventually translated by a member of the editorial staff.
The order came from M. Georges Vincent, of Lyons, who described himself as “etant un fervent d’athletlsme.” He asked an account to be sent for the equivalent of $2 in francs.
